AI model takes on clickbaiters

Bachelor of Computer Science (Honours) students, Bhanuka Samarasekara Vitharana Gamage, Adnan Labib, and Aisha Joomun, collaborated in a final year project titled “Baitradar: A Multi-model Clickbait Detection Algorithm using Deep Learning”. The project focuses on developing an artificial intelligence (AI) model that will predict whether a YouTube video is a ‘clickbait’ or not. Good news! This project was accepted for presentation at the 46th IEEE International Conference on Acoustics, Speech and Signal Processing (ICASSP) 2021.
